Transaction 58562706f701b07f8801089d31bf0f40e513a86123d341ce071a00ea4fa41eab
1 Input
2 Outputs
- 58562706f701b07f8801089d31bf0f40e513a86123d341ce071a00ea4fa41eab:0
- 58562706f701b07f8801089d31bf0f40e513a86123d341ce071a00ea4fa41eab:1
value 347300
address 1FywbywBUp7QC9rLdhfYpi9mvVxzZcxq9u
value 6376828
address 17gTKTfbznzNTh2CLrLZyHq7rRgPqwHxjo